Description

Tucked along a quiet, tree-lined street where Halifax’s West End and North End meet, this charming Andrew Cobb-designed home offers a rare blend of character, comfort, and urban convenience. Located in a peaceful, community-focused neighbourhood, you’re just minutes from downtown Halifax, parks, amenities, and excellent schools, with Oxford School only a block away. Inside, timeless character shines through with original vintage doors, glass doorknobs, and classic architectural details that reflect the home’s history and charm. The thoughtful layout offers comfortable living spaces on the main level with private bedrooms upstairs, creating an ideal flow for everyday living, entertaining, or working from home. The striking bathroom was fully renovated in 2021, restoring its vintage appeal with statement wallpaper and a custom walnut vanity handcrafted by a local woodworker. Beautifully maintained throughout, the home balances preserved character with practical modern updates. Step outside to a sunny, private backyard retreat featuring a newer deck, plenty of room to relax or entertain, and three raised garden beds ready for summer planting. Whether enjoying morning coffee or evenings with friends, the outdoor space adds to the home’s appeal. Additional updates include a newer roof (2020), oil tank (2020), and several brand-new appliances, including the fridge, dishwasher, and washer. The manageable size makes this property ideal for professionals, couples, or young families seeking the benefits of a detached home in one of Halifax’s most walkable neighbourhoods. There is also future potential in the attic space, offering possibilities similar to neighbouring homes for added living space, a home office, or private retreat. Full of warmth, history, and personality, this is a rare opportunity in one of Halifax’s most desirable urban neighbourhoods.
